2. History and Evolution

The journey of Dive Photography and Videography dates back to the early 20th century, a time when underwater imaging was an emerging field filled with challenges and discoveries. Initially, underwater photography was limited to black-and-white images captured using bulky and rudimentary equipment. The pioneers of this art form, such as William Longley and Charles Martin, made significant strides by developing specialized housing to protect cameras from water damage. Their work laid the groundwork for future advancements, opening the door to a new way of exploring the ocean’s depths.

Early Beginnings of Underwater Imaging

In the early days, capturing images beneath the waves was a formidable task. Equipment was cumbersome, and the lack of suitable lighting made it difficult to produce clear images. Innovators like Jacques Cousteau and Hans Hass were instrumental in overcoming these challenges. Cousteau, with engineer Émile Gagnan, co-invented the Aqua-Lung, which revolutionized diving and allowed photographers to spend more time underwater. His work in the 1940s and 1950s, including the development of underwater cameras, significantly advanced the field of Dive Photography and Videography.

During this period, underwater exploration was primarily driven by scientific inquiry and curiosity. Photographers and videographers played a crucial role in documenting marine life and habitats, providing valuable insights into the previously hidden world beneath the ocean’s surface. Their work not only fueled public interest in marine biology but also laid the foundation for modern underwater imaging techniques.

Technological Advancements Over the Decades

The evolution of Dive Photography and Videography accelerated with technological advancements in the latter half of the 20th century. The introduction of color film transformed underwater imagery, allowing for more vibrant and realistic depictions of marine environments. The 1970s and 1980s saw the emergence of more sophisticated camera housings and improved lighting systems, which enhanced image quality and expanded creative possibilities.

Digital technology marked a new era in Dive Photography and Videography. The development of digital cameras and high-definition video equipment in the 1990s and early 2000s revolutionized the industry, making it more accessible and versatile. These innovations allowed photographers and videographers to experiment with new techniques and share their work with a global audience. Today, the availability of compact, durable cameras and advanced post-processing software has made it easier than ever to capture stunning underwater imagery.

Housings and Ports

Protecting your camera from water damage is paramount, and this is where housings and ports come into play. These waterproof enclosures are specifically designed to seal your camera, ensuring functionality and image clarity underwater. When choosing a housing, consider the material and port type.

  • Material Considerations: Housings are typically made from polycarbonate or aluminum. Polycarbonate is lightweight and affordable, while aluminum offers superior durability and is often preferred by professionals diving in challenging conditions.
  • Dome vs. Flat Ports: The choice between dome and flat ports depends on your photographic objectives. Dome ports are excellent for wide-angle shots, minimizing distortion and improving image quality. Flat ports are suitable for macro photography, allowing you to focus on small, intricate details.

Lighting: Strobes and Video Lights

Lighting is a critical element in Dive Photography and Videography. Natural light diminishes rapidly underwater, resulting in color loss and reduced visibility. To counteract this, artificial lighting is essential for capturing vibrant and well-exposed images.

  • Importance of Artificial Lighting: Strobes and video lights help restore the colors lost due to water absorption, enhancing the overall quality of your images and videos. They also illuminate subjects, creating depth and contrast.
  • Techniques for Optimal Lighting: Positioning your lights correctly is crucial for achieving the best results. Angle your strobes or video lights to avoid backscatter, which occurs when particles in the water reflect the light back into the lens. Experiment with different lighting angles and intensities to highlight your subject effectively.

Pre-Dive Checks and Maintenance

Before you embark on your underwater photography adventure, it is crucial to perform comprehensive pre-dive checks and maintenance on your equipment. These steps help prevent equipment failure and ensure that you are fully prepared for the dive.

  • Inspect your Equipment: Carefully examine your camera, housing, and lighting systems for any signs of wear or damage. Ensure that all seals and O-rings are intact and free of debris to maintain watertight integrity.
  • Battery and Memory Card Checks: Verify that your camera batteries are fully charged, and you have adequate memory card storage for the duration of your dive. It’s advisable to carry spare batteries and memory cards.
  • Functional Testing: Test your camera and lighting settings on dry land to ensure everything is functioning correctly. Familiarize yourself with camera controls in case you need to make adjustments underwater.

Composition and Framing Underwater

Composition is a fundamental aspect of photography, and in the underwater realm, it requires special consideration. The dynamic nature of the ocean means that you must be prepared to adapt quickly to changing conditions and subjects.

  • Rule of Thirds: This classic compositional technique involves dividing your frame into a grid of nine equal parts and placing your subject along the lines or at their intersections. This helps create balanced and engaging images.
  • Use of Leading Lines: Look for natural lines created by coral formations, fish schools, or light patterns that guide the viewer’s eye through the image. These can add depth and interest to your photos.
  • Foreground Interest: Include elements in the foreground to give context and scale to your subject. This is especially effective in wide-angle shots, where you want to capture expansive scenes.

Managing Buoyancy for Stability

Stable buoyancy control is essential for achieving sharp images in Dive Photography and Videography. Uncontrolled movement can lead to blurry photos and potential harm to delicate marine environments.

  • Practice Neutral Buoyancy: Achieving neutral buoyancy allows you to hover effortlessly in the water, minimizing movement. This stability is crucial for composing and shooting effectively.
  • Use Your Breathing: Fine-tune your buoyancy by controlling your breathing. Inhale to rise slightly and exhale to sink, allowing for precise positioning without using your hands.
  • Additional Weights: Consider using trim weights or ankle weights to distribute your buoyancy evenly and prevent unwanted tilting or drifting.

Understanding Color Loss and White Balance

Color loss is a significant challenge in underwater photography, as water absorbs light and filters out colors, particularly reds and oranges. Understanding how to address this issue is key to producing vibrant images.

  • Use Manual White Balance: Adjusting your camera’s white balance manually can help restore the natural colors of your subjects. Experiment with settings or use a white slate for calibration before diving.
  • Supplement with Strobes: External strobes or video lights can reintroduce lost colors by providing artificial light. Position them to eliminate shadows and bring out the true hues of marine life.
  • Post-Processing Adjustments: Use editing software to fine-tune colors and contrast after your dive. Enhancing vibrancy and correcting white balance in post-production can significantly improve image quality.

Sound Recording Challenges and Solutions

Sound plays a vital role in enhancing the immersive quality of your underwater videos. However, recording audio underwater presents unique challenges due to water’s properties and ambient noise.

  • Use Waterproof Microphones: Specialized microphones designed for underwater use can capture ambient sounds like bubbles and marine life interactions, adding authenticity to your footage.
  • Enhance in Post-Production: Due to limitations in recording underwater, consider enhancing soundtracks during editing. Ambient sound libraries can provide realistic audio elements to complement your visuals.
  • Minimize Noise: Be mindful of your equipment and movement, as these can introduce unwanted noise. Adjust your positioning to capture cleaner audio, especially in calmer waters like New Zealand’s Fiordland National Park.

File Management and Backup Strategies

Effective file management is the backbone of a successful Dive Photography and Videography practice. With potentially hundreds of images and video clips captured during a single dive, organizing and backing up your data is crucial to prevent loss and ensure easy retrieval.

  • Organize Your Files: Develop a consistent file naming and folder structure. Consider categorizing files by location, date, and subject for straightforward navigation and retrieval.
  • Immediate Backup: As soon as possible after your dive, back up your files to at least two different locations. This could include an external hard drive and a cloud service like Google Drive or Dropbox. This redundancy protects your work against data loss.
  • Use Metadata: Utilize metadata tags to label your files with key information such as dive site, camera settings, and notable subjects. This additional layer of organization aids in future searches and project planning.

Overcoming Environmental Obstacles

The underwater environment presents unique challenges that can affect visibility, stability, and the quality of captured images and videos. Various factors like water turbidity, currents, and low light conditions can all impact the outcome of your work.

  • Turbidity and Visibility: Turbid waters, often caused by high sediment levels, can reduce visibility and clarity. To counteract this, dive during periods of calm weather and avoid areas where recent storms or tides may have stirred up sediment. Exploring dive sites like the Poor Knights Islands, known for clearer waters, can also mitigate these issues.
  • Currents and Stability: Strong currents can make it difficult to maintain stability and composition. Practice good buoyancy control and consider using a dive hook or reef hook to secure yourself in place when shooting in areas with significant water movement.
  • Low Light Conditions: The deeper you dive, the less natural light is available, which can lead to darker images. Utilizing powerful strobes or video lights can help illuminate subjects and restore natural colors lost at depth.

Dealing with Equipment Malfunctions

Equipment malfunctions are an inevitable part of Dive Photography and Videography. These issues can range from minor inconveniences to major setbacks, but with proper preparation, many problems can be averted or swiftly resolved.

  • Regular Maintenance: Conduct thorough checks of your camera, housing, and lighting equipment before each dive. Ensure that O-rings are clean and lubricated, and that batteries are fully charged. Regular servicing of your gear by professionals can also prevent unexpected failures.
  • Spare Parts and Tools: Carry a small kit with essential spare parts such as O-rings, batteries, and tools. This preparedness allows you to perform quick repairs on-site, minimizing downtime and preventing lost photo opportunities.
  • Testing Before Diving: Always test your equipment on land before entering the water. This allows you to identify and resolve any issues with settings, functionality, or seals in a controlled environment.

Freshwater Diving

Freshwater environments, such as lakes and rivers, offer a different set of challenges and features for Dive Photography and Videography. New Zealand’s freshwater dive sites, like Lake Taupo, are renowned for their crystal-clear water and unique geological formations.

  • Clarity and Visibility: Freshwater often offers extraordinary clarity, allowing for detailed captures of geological features and aquatic life. However, sediment can reduce visibility quickly, especially after rain, necessitating careful planning and timing for optimal conditions.
  • Unique Subjects: Freshwater ecosystems host different species compared to marine environments, such as trout or eels, which require understanding their behavior and habitats for effective photography. Additionally, unique geological formations like underwater caves or submerged trees provide intriguing subjects.
  • Equipment Considerations: The absence of salt means less corrosion on equipment, but divers should be mindful of colder temperatures affecting battery life and condensation inside housings, necessitating proper equipment checks and maintenance.

Highlight: Diverse Dive Sites in New Zealand

New Zealand is home to a range of dive sites that offer diverse experiences for photographers and videographers. The country’s geographical diversity provides a rich tapestry of underwater landscapes waiting to be captured.

  • Fiordland National Park: Known for its stunning fjords and black coral gardens, Fiordland offers unique underwater topographies. The mix of saltwater and freshwater creates a distinct ecosystem, providing opportunities to capture rare species found nowhere else.
  • White Island (Whakaari): As an active marine volcano, White Island offers dramatic underwater landscapes with geothermal activity. Photographers can capture the unique interplay of volcanic vents and marine life, a rare combination found in few places worldwide.
  • HMS Canterbury Wreck: Located in the Bay of Islands, this purpose-sunk wreck provides an artificial reef teeming with life. The structure offers a different dimension to underwater photography, where divers can explore varying depths and interior environments.
